About 3D Aesthetics

3D Aesthetics is a customer-focused, award-winning supplier of non-surgical aesthetic devices to the Beauty, Aesthetic, and Medical industries. Our devices enable professionals to offer some of the UK's most in-demand treatments, including body contouring, Hydro2Facials, and laser hair removal. Trusted by industry professionals and loved by celebrities, our brand is regularly featured in the national media

The Role

As a Business Development Manager, you'll take ownership of your regional territory (North of England & Scotland) developing new business opportunities, managing key accounts, and converting inbound leads to revenue. You'll also represent 3D Aesthetics at trade shows and company events, webinars, and client e-meetings, showcasing our innovative product range and building long-term partnerships.
